Why You Need Antivirus Software for Your Phone
Before diving into the best free antivirus options, let’s first discuss why having mobile antivirus protection is critical:
-
Increasing Malware Threats: Mobile malware is increasing rapidly. According to recent reports, the number of mobile threats has surged over the past few years, targeting your personal information, financial data, and even your device itself.
-
Public Wi-Fi Vulnerabilities: Using public Wi-Fi can expose your device to cybersecurity threats. Without proper protection, you could easily fall victim to hackers trying to steal your data.
-
Phishing Scams: Cybercriminals often use phishing tactics to lure users into downloading malicious applications or visiting harmful websites. Antivirus software helps mitigate this risk by identifying these threats before they can do harm.
-
Device Performance: Many antivirus applications also help improve your phone’s performance by clearing unnecessary files and optimizing memory usage.

How to Choose the Right Antivirus for Your Phone
With multiple options available, selecting the best free antivirus can be a daunting task. Here are some key factors to consider:
1. Protection Features
Ensure the antivirus provides robust protection against malware, spyware, and other threats. Look for features such as real-time scanning, phishing protection, and privacy safeguards.
2. Performance Impact
Some antivirus applications can significantly slow down your device. Choose an option that offers comprehensive protection without compromising your phone’s performance.
3. User Experience
A user-friendly interface can make navigating your antivirus software a lot easier. Look for applications that are intuitive and easy to understand.
4. Additional Tools
Consider whether the antivirus offers any additional features like a VPN, app locking, or storage optimization. These can add value to your mobile security suite.
5. Customer Support
Good customer support can be a lifesaver, especially if you encounter issues or need help with setup. Check reviews to see how responsive the support for each antivirus option is.
